II.19 ACADEMIC STAFF PROFESSIONAL DEVELOPMENT FUNDING

The UW System offers a professional development program for academic staff members. Applications may be made once a year. Procedures are announced through Wisconsin Week and coordinated by the Academic Personnel Office.   Dean's Office review is required. The program typically provides half (50%) of the cost of an approved project; the department will be expected to cover the remaining half and should explain how it will cover its match using departmental sources of support.  (More information is available online at http://www.ohrd.wisc.edu/grants/index.asp.)

The provision of travel funds for academic staff members attending professional conferences is primarily a departmental matter. However, to encourage such professional development activities on the part of academic staff, the College will provide a limited number of grants of up to $300 to match the departmental contribution for academic staff members giving a paper at, or otherwise actively participating in, a professional conference. This funding is normally available only for academic staff whose appointments are on 101 funds and would be available no more than once per year per academic staff member. To seek such matching funding, send a request with a description of the conference and the academic staff member's role in it to the appropriate Associate Dean.
